Transaction c866c652de387921eeb15b0074be1bed11c038c267aac2fdad387fbf70d1f1ea
1 Input
1 Output
-
c866c652de387921eeb15b0074be1bed11c038c267aac2fdad387fbf70d1f1ea:0
- value
- 3520587
- script pubkey
- OP_0 OP_PUSHBYTES_20 b3dd8ff04e0a2e73783eafbd59f48ecdfbc3808f
- address
- bc1qk0wcluzwpgh8x7p74774naywehau8qy0cg33h3